Why Energy Storage Matters in Renewable Energy Systems

Solar and wind energy face inherent intermittency challenges – the sun doesn't always shine, and wind patterns fluctuate. Energy storage systems like EK SOLAR's solution act as "energy insurance policies", providing three key benefits:

  • Storing surplus solar energy during peak production hours
  • Releasing stored power during high-demand periods
  • Stabilizing grid frequency and voltage

The Economic Equation

While upfront costs remain a consideration, storage systems demonstrate compelling ROI:

  • Peak shaving reduces energy purchase costs by 18-35%
  • Battery prices fell 89% between 2010-2020 (BloombergNEF)
  • 7-9 year payback period for commercial installations

Future Trends in Energy Storage

Emerging technologies promise even greater efficiency:

  • Solid-state battery prototypes achieving 500 Wh/kg density
  • Flow batteries for long-duration storage (8+ hours)
  • Blockchain-enabled peer-to-peer energy trading

FAQs: Energy Storage Power Stations

  • Q: How long do storage systems typically last? A: Modern systems maintain 80% capacity after 10-15 years
  • Q: Can existing solar farms retrofit storage? A: Yes, most can integrate storage with minimal infrastructure upgrades
